Did your system auto update to win11?

Under windows start>tools>services ...

Depending on your windows, any service that is followed by this ending will not be allowed to be altered at all. ex: UdkUserSvc_4234d. Perhaps a registry edit.
Almost all services can be altered in registry, but this is not advisable for anyone who is not thoroughly familiar with the registry itself.

These are services I've been disabling for years without damage, but windows still finds a way.
I also disable any MS store crap and all telemetry and biometric services possible. None have effected my running of the system to this day. Telemetry and biometric services tend to be entirely internal system programs by windows to scan and check your personal computer, ostensibly for security reasons and updates.

Update Orchestrator Service - stays disabled
Windows Insider Service - stays disabled
Windows Update - this service disabled in services window, however randomly gets reset without any updates done.
Windows Update Medic Service - will not allow change except to stop and manual, but restarts on boot.
Microsoft Update Health Service - this service has stayed disabled.

I don't think I've seen any unknown action since and when going to settings and looking at the landing page I don't see any little red blinkies either. Clicking on windows update from that page as if just to open the info page itself will let windows try to call home automatically so I don't go beyond that.
